Youth Sector Challenges

1 March 2021

Recent reports from UK Youth and Children & Young People Now highlight the challenges facing youth services and young people.

Newly published data from UK Youth finds a 66% rise in the demand for youth services which are battling rising costs and a reduction in funding. Read more here.
